HI, I have install Android Studio 2.3.3 on Ubuntu machine. I am having 8 GB ram with Corei5 Processor. As per recommendation for android studio it is enough.
There is very interesting issue while my developers started working on android studio at morning it works great. But in evening its getting very slow.... I am having 7 developers with same configuration and same is happening with everyone. While investigate the same I found that we should consider for RAM up-gradation. But i have checked the behaviour of RAM utilisation in all 7 systems & found very interesting observation. While running studio in morning RAM is 20% utilised & that is OK. While running build for first time it get increased by 25% & that is also OK. If I run build one more time then it get increased from 25% to 30. At the end of day it get increased to 95%. Interesting thing is that after finishing build RAM utilisation does not decrease & therefor if I run build again & again it get start increase from last utilisation point. If I restart studio with invalidate cache option then RAM utilisation decreased to normal. As per my observation after finishing build RAM utilisation should decrease.
